Hong Kong Goverments prepares for Biological Warfare
31/07/2008

The terrorist group (Turkestan Islamic Party) have earlier warned and threatened Beijing and its olympic co-host cities that they will launch unpredictable terrorist attacks which included the attack of chemical weapons. As the opening day of Olympics is soon,and facing threats. Hong Kong goverment have studied for the first time about the attack of chemical weapons. They have discovered that Kowloon District has got the highest amount of dangerous chemicals which included commercial incendiary agents,and dissolvents. Among these dangerous chemicals,there were no antidotes for 92% of them,if these dangerous chemicals falls into the hands of the terrorists,many life will be lost.


(As explosives and dangerous chemicals could be hidden in vehicles,there would be more
sentries on the road to check the vehicles)


Dangerous chemicals were found in 1276 areas

The experts recommended the Hong Kong Goverment to make preparations before the Olympic starts. They advised the goverment to check if the antidotes for the dangerous chemicals were sufficient to use during an emergency,and if the health workers were properly trained to handle such situations.

The goverment requests all civilians to be alert and store their dangerous chemicals in a safe place. An exercise will be organised later to prepare the people for the real emergency. Health workers will need to cancel their leave and work during the Olympics. They will also be ensured that there is sufficient training and learnt the knowledge of emergency treatment.
